Kustannusvastuita, a Finnish term, translates to "cost responsibility" in English. It refers to the principle or system where individuals or entities are held financially accountable for the costs incurred due to their actions or decisions. This concept is widely applied in various sectors, including healthcare, social services, and environmental management, to promote efficient resource use and discourage wasteful or harmful behavior.
